NEWS: Hawks compete against the best

Hethersett Hawks/Swinton & Co took on some of the best riders in the UK when they contested the British Open Club Championship at Harford Park in Norwich. Facing Wednesfield, Birmingham, Ipswich and Kesgrave on a very fast track they gave a spirited performance and at half-time were in touch with the leaders only to fade away as the racing got much more competitive. Even so they finished a creditable fourth and would have scored many more points if races had not been stopped and rerun by the referee when the Hawks were well-placed.

Dan Chambers looked very sharp as he has stepped up his training prior to the forthcoming World Championships and he provided the only Hawks’ heat winner in heat 3. Leigh Cossey used his vast experience to defend good positions and Lee Grange and Olly Buxton were well in the mix for most of their heats.

BIRMINGHAM 52 IPSWICH 47 WEDNESFIELD 39 HETHERSETT 31 KESGRAVE 28

Hethersett scorers: Dan Chambers 10 Leigh Cossey 8 Lee Grange 7 Olly Buxton 6, Roger Carter (sub – not used)
